It is 4.37 GB (4,699,979,776 bytes) to be exact, all of them are, except dual layer. But a file size of 4.35 GiB does not need a dual layer disc. From wiki: 'Unlike the Nintendo GameCube, Wii game discs use the standard DVD size, which enables them to hold more memory than the GameCube discs: up to 4.37 GB (4,699,979,776 bytes) for single-layered discs, and up to 7.92 GB (8,511,160,320 bytes) for dual layered discs.'

Also, I am now noticing that the site I copied that info from used the wrong nomenclature: 'Unlike the Nintendo GameCube, Wii game discs use the standard DVD size, which enables them to hold more memory than the GameCube discs: up to 4.37 GB (4,699,979,776 bytes) for single-layered discs, and up to 7.92 GB (8,511,160,320 bytes) for dual layered discs.' SHOULD READ: 'Unlike the Nintendo GameCube, Wii game discs use the standard DVD size, which enables them to hold more memory than the GameCube discs: up to 4.37 GiB (4,699,979,776 bytes OR 4.7 GB) for single-layered discs, and up to 7.92 GiB (8,511,160,320 bytes or 8.5 GB) for dual layered discs.'
